How to Sell in Cape Canaveral: What Works

Lead with Port Canaveral employment proximity for cruise industry buyers

Port Canaveral is one of the busiest cruise ports in the world — home to Carnival, Royal Caribbean, Disney Cruise Line, and Norwegian operations. The port employs thousands of workers in cruise operations, ship maintenance, hospitality, and logistics who specifically seek affordable housing within minutes of Port Canaveral. Cape Canaveral is the closest residential community to the port. Market the commute time (typically 5–10 minutes to port) explicitly if your property is buyer-accessible for port workers.

Document canal access and ocean access correctly — buyers ask

Cape Canaveral has a mix of properties: oceanfront condos on A1A, canal-front homes with Banana River and ocean access, interior residential streets, and Port Canaveral-adjacent neighborhoods. Canal-front homes with boat access to the Banana River and Atlantic Ocean are a specific product that commands a premium from boating and fishing buyers. Confirm and document the water access for your property type. Buyers comparing Cape Canaveral canal homes to Cocoa Beach canal homes will ask about lock access and ocean access conditions.

Price against Cocoa Beach — Cape Canaveral typically offers a 10–20% discount

Cape Canaveral generally prices 10–20% below comparable Cocoa Beach properties due to the Cocoa Beach brand premium and walkability of Cocoa Beach's commercial corridor. This discount is a selling advantage when marketing to value-oriented buyers, but it also means you cannot price at Cocoa Beach levels without comparable amenity and condition. Pull comps from within Cape Canaveral (32920) specifically. The Port Canaveral end of Cape Canaveral (closer to the port) trades differently than the southern end near Cocoa Beach.

Target remote workers and lifestyle buyers who have been priced out of Cocoa Beach

Cocoa Beach's rising prices have pushed buyers toward adjacent Cape Canaveral, which offers similar Atlantic access at lower prices. Remote workers, early retirees, and lifestyle buyers who want walkable beach access but can't afford Cocoa Beach's premiums find Cape Canaveral a compelling alternative. Market the walking and biking access to the beach, the proximity to Cocoa Beach's restaurants and nightlife, and the value differential versus Cocoa Beach comps.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are homes selling for in Cape Canaveral in 2026?

Cape Canaveral home prices in 2026 range from approximately $280,000 for smaller interior homes and condos to $650,000+ for oceanfront condos and canal-front single-family homes. Most single-family non-waterfront transactions occur in the $350,000–$540,000 range. Canal-front homes with Banana River access command a premium over interior homes. The 32920 zip code covers all of Cape Canaveral and includes properties ranging from low-rise condos to single-family neighborhoods.

How close is Cape Canaveral to Kennedy Space Center?

Cape Canaveral is approximately 15–20 minutes from Kennedy Space Center's main gate via SR-528 (the Beachline) and SR-401. The Cape Canaveral Space Force Station — which houses many launch facilities — is adjacent to the city. The area's aerospace employment base (KSC, SpaceX, Blue Origin, Rocket Lab, Boeing) makes Cape Canaveral a commute-practical option for aerospace workers who also want beach lifestyle.

Are there canal homes with boat access in Cape Canaveral?

Yes — Cape Canaveral has a network of canals that connect to the Banana River and ultimately provide ocean access through Port Canaveral's locks. Canal-front homes in Cape Canaveral are popular with boating buyers who want to keep a boat in their backyard with access to offshore fishing and cruising. Boat owners should verify the canal dimensions (depth, width, bridge clearances) for their specific vessel before purchasing. Proximity to Port Canaveral's commercial lock system means easy Atlantic access.

How does Cape Canaveral compare to Cocoa Beach for sellers?

Cape Canaveral and Cocoa Beach are adjacent municipalities sharing the same barrier island. Cocoa Beach commands a brand premium due to its entertainment corridor, Ron Jon Surf Shop, and established tourist economy. Cape Canaveral is generally quieter and residential, with a stronger Port-adjacent character. For sellers, this means Cape Canaveral prices typically run 10–20% below Cocoa Beach for comparable properties. Days on market are similar when correctly priced. Cape Canaveral's buyer pool skews toward value-oriented buyers, aerospace workers, and boating enthusiasts rather than pure lifestyle buyers.
